The Essence of YSL Libre
Yves Saint Laurent Libre represents a bold departure from conventional feminine fragrances. At its core, Libre challenges traditional gender norms in perfumery by prominently featuring lavender, a note typically associated with masculine scents. This daring choice is masterfully balanced with the rich, sensual embrace of vanilla, creating a fragrance that is at once assertive and inviting.
The concept behind Libre aligns perfectly with Yves Saint Laurent’s heritage of pushing boundaries in fashion and beauty. Just as the brand’s iconic Le Smoking tuxedo for women revolutionized fashion in the 1960s, Libre seeks to redefine the landscape of modern fragrances. It embodies the spirit of freedom and self-expression that has long been a hallmark of the YSL brand.
Fragrance Composition
The olfactory pyramid of YSL Libre is a study in contrasts, skillfully blended to create a harmonious whole:
- Top Notes: The fragrance opens with a burst of mandarin orange and a unique lavender essence, specifically developed for Libre. This lavender is brighter and more refined than traditional variations, offering a fresh, aromatic introduction.
- Heart Notes: The floral heart of Libre unfolds with jasmine sambac and orange blossom. These white floral notes add a touch of feminine elegance, softening the aromatic opening.
- Base Notes: The foundation of the fragrance rests on a luxurious blend of Madagascar vanilla, cedarwood, and musk. The vanilla, in particular, plays a crucial role in defining the character of Libre, providing a warm, sensual backdrop that complements the cooler lavender tones.
This carefully orchestrated composition creates a scent that evolves beautifully on the skin, revealing different facets of its character throughout the day.
Scent Profile and Development
Upon first application, YSL Libre announces itself with a crisp, aromatic burst of lavender, immediately setting it apart from other feminine fragrances. This opening is bright and invigorating, with the mandarin orange adding a subtle citrusy sparkle.
As the fragrance settles, the floral heart begins to emerge. The jasmine and orange blossom notes soften the aromatic edge of the lavender, introducing a more traditionally feminine aspect to the scent. This transition is smooth and elegant, never jarring or abrupt.
In the dry down, the true magic of Libre unfolds. The rich, creamy vanilla base rises to meet the lavender, creating a mesmerizing interplay between cool aromatics and warm sweetness. This dance between lavender and vanilla continues throughout the wear, with each note taking turns in the spotlight. The cedarwood and musk add depth and longevity, ensuring that the fragrance remains interesting and complex for hours.
Performance and Longevity
YSL Libre is formulated as an Eau de Parfum, with a concentration of fragrance oils typically ranging between 15% and 20%. This high concentration contributes to its impressive performance, with many users reporting longevity of 8 to 12 hours or more. The sillage of Libre is moderate to strong, creating a noticeable presence without overwhelming the senses.
It leaves a subtle trail, inviting intrigue without dominating a room. This balanced projection makes Libre suitable for both intimate gatherings and professional settings. The fragrance’s excellent longevity can be attributed to its high-quality ingredients and thoughtful composition. The use of long-lasting base notes like vanilla and cedarwood ensures that the scent continues to captivate throughout its wear.
Versatility and Occasion
YSL Libre’s sophisticated composition allows for remarkable versatility. Its fresh, aromatic opening makes it suitable for daytime wear, particularly in professional settings where its confident aura can be an asset. As the fragrance develops, its warmer, more sensual base notes come to the fore, making it equally appropriate for evening events and romantic encounters.
While Libre shines in all seasons, its lavender notes make it particularly refreshing in spring and summer. However, the warm vanilla base provides enough depth to carry the fragrance beautifully into cooler months as well.
Packaging and Presentation
The bottle design of YSL Libre is a work of art in itself, reflecting the fragrance’s fusion of strength and elegance. The asymmetrical glass flacon features sharp, masculine-inspired edges softened by graceful curves. The oversized gold YSL logo serves as both decoration and a nod to the brand’s fashion heritage, resembling a necklace draped over the bottle.
The juice itself is tinted a pale gold, visible through the clear glass and adding to the overall luxurious aesthetic. The weighty cap, adorned with the YSL logo, provides a satisfying sense of quality with each use.
